Live Nativity Scene Set for Town Circle in Georgetown

There will be a Nativity Scene in Georgetown’s town circle after all.

WBOC reports that it will be a live scene sponsored by the non-profit Good Ole Boy Foundation.

The city had barred any unattended display due to safety considerations.

The foundation is seeking assistance ranging from cast members and costumes to the singing of carols.

Meanwhile, Pastor Wood Bates of the First Baptist Church told the television station that this will improve community involvement in the display.
